A photo that was snapped of a rather lovely looking young lady, who obviously had a little too much Cup Cheer, at the NZ Cup, right next to Smoken Up should be of massive concern, in particular to the officials in NZ.
In finding against Lance and Smoken Up's connections at the Inter Dom Inquiry, they clearly labelled the trainer as being totally responsible for anyone who may have come into contact with the horse at the ID11 thus refuting the Smoken Up camp's claim of contamination/contact with DMSO, accidental or otherwise. They also stated that the trainer must present the horse to race free of prohibited substances and by their definition, presented to race meaning right up to the score up.
Now how is Lance, or any of the trainer/drivers who competed in the cup yesterday meant to protect their horses from someone leaping the fence and getting close enough to pat a horse.
Now I want to say that in no way am I inferring that this lady snapped in the photo contacted any horse...but what If?????
